A 72-year-old citizen of Serbia, MP, who is suspected of having tried to kill her seven-year-old son on Tuesday evening, has been in Spuša prison since yesterday. After the hearing, the prosecutor on duty, Maja Jovanović, ordered her to be detained for up to XNUMX hours.

Lawyer Božo Milonjić, who officially represents the suspect, told Vijesti that the MoJ presented a defense during which she denied the commission of a criminal act.

"However, as it is a foreign citizen, the prosecutor ordered the detention of the suspect due to the risk of escape, but also due to the influence on the witnesses who have yet to be heard, said lawyer Milonjić.

A seven-year-old boy, let us remind you, was brought to the Children's Hospital in Podgorica on Tuesday evening shortly after 19:XNUMX pm with multiple stab wounds in the chest area. After that, he underwent emergency surgery. After the operation, the boy is stable and out of danger.

On the occasion of this event, the Police Administration also announced.

"Officials of the OB Cetinje were informed by the Emergency Medical Service that they took over a seven-year-old boy with body injuries that were most likely caused by the impact of a sharp object".

The boy was hospitalized.

Taking measures and actions and based on information collected from citizens, in coordination with the state prosecutor in the Higher State Prosecutor's Office in Podgorica, police officers deprived the MP of her freedom due to the existence of reasonable suspicion that she had committed the criminal offense of aggravated attempted murder, the statement reads.

Everything happened in a rented house in Rijeka Crnojevića, and the suspect's neighbors reported the case to the police.

"Arriving at the house where the suspect was staying with her son, the police found the door locked and upon entering a gruesome scene. "There was blood everywhere," says our interlocutor, adding that during the investigation, a knife was also found with which, it is suspected, the MP tried to kill her son.

According to unofficial information, the boy was previously physically abused by his mother. However, despite the possible speculation that the child's mother was brought to the competent authorities several times by the neighbors, the Cetinje Center for Social Work claims that they have not received a single complaint against the suspect.

"Not a single report of domestic violence was recorded in the records of the Ju Center for Social Work. The family of the MP did not exercise a single right from the Law on Social and Child Protection," the statement says.
